Kemper Wins Lifetime Fitness Triathlon on Carbon TT Wheels
American Hunter Kemper won the 2006 Life Time Fitness Triathlon and prevailed in the ''Battle of the Sexes'' contest to claim the sport’s largest winner’s purse of $200,000.
Six-time US National Triathlon Champion and 2005 World #1 ranked triathlete, Hunter Kemper competed against a stellar field of elite professional triathletes from around the world and won the event's $200,000-value first-place prize while aboard Rolf Prima’s new Carbon TT wheels.
The event's innovative timing structure, in which the women received a 9 minute and 49 second handicap this year, allowed the field of world elite professional male and female triathletes to battle on equal ground for the top prize.
